温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

如何评估Web开发框架的易用性

发布时间:2025-11-15 09:40:00 来源:亿速云 阅读:88 作者:小樊 栏目:软件技术

评估Web开发框架的易用性是一个重要的过程,因为它可以帮助你确定哪个框架最适合你的项目需求。以下是一些评估Web开发框架易用性的关键因素:

  1. 学习曲线

    • 评估框架的学习曲线,即从新手到熟练掌握所需的时间和努力。
    • 查看官方文档的质量和完整性,以及是否有丰富的教程、示例和社区支持。
  2. 语法和结构

    • 检查框架的语法是否简洁明了,易于理解和记忆。
    • 评估框架的结构是否清晰,模块化程度如何,以及是否遵循了常见的编程范式。
  3. API设计

    • 评估框架提供的API是否直观、一致且易于使用。
    • 检查API的文档是否详细,包括参数说明、返回值类型、错误处理等。
  4. 集成与扩展性

    • 评估框架与其他工具和库的集成能力,例如数据库、缓存系统、消息队列等。
    • 检查框架是否提供了良好的扩展性,以便在未来根据需要进行定制和扩展。
  5. 性能

    • 虽然性能不是直接与易用性相关,但一个高性能的框架可以减少开发过程中的瓶颈,提高整体效率。
    • 评估框架在处理大量请求、高并发场景下的表现。
  6. 社区与生态系统

    • 一个活跃的社区和丰富的生态系统可以为开发者提供更多的资源和支持。
    • 检查框架是否有大量的第三方库、插件和工具可供使用。
  7. 安全性

    • 评估框架在安全性方面的表现,包括输入验证、输出编码、防止SQL注入、跨站脚本攻击(XSS)等。
    • 检查框架是否提供了安全配置选项和最佳实践指南。
  8. 测试与调试

    • 评估框架是否提供了方便的测试工具和调试功能,以帮助开发者快速定位和解决问题。
    • 检查框架是否支持单元测试、集成测试和端到端测试。
  9. 许可与成本

    • 了解框架的许可协议,确保它符合你的项目需求和预算。
    • 评估框架的成本,包括购买许可证、托管费用等。

通过综合考虑以上因素,你可以对Web开发框架的易用性进行全面的评估,并选择最适合你项目的框架。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I